Rocket 97 – $92

The surprise of the day was experienced in Houston, where the Rockets occupying last place in the West defeated the mighty Milwaukee Bucks. Giannis Antetokounmpo (16 points and 18 rebounds), the second best team in the entire league behind the Boston Celtics.

Jalen Green (30 points, 7 rebounds) lead Houston juru holiday (25 points, 6 rebounds, 8 assists) did the same for the Bucks, who only made 36.7% of their shots.

Spanish Serge Ibaka Didn’t play for the Bucks.his compatriot Usman Galba 2 points, 2 rebounds and 1 block in 11 minutes in Houston.world chris middleton He only played six minutes for Milwaukee before leaving the game with an ankle injury.

Knicks 122 – 99 Kings

The New York Knicks’ fourth victory was at Madison Square Garden, with authority (already 36-22 in the first quarter), against the Sacramento Kings. Domantas Sabonis (20 points and 12 rebounds).

RJ Barrett (27 points, 9 rebounds, 6 assists) Julius Randle (27 points and 8 rebounds before being ejected in the third quarter for protests) led the New Yorkers.

Magic 111 – 99 Raptors

They’ve only won five games in their first 25 games, but the Magic picked up momentum and went on to win three in a row this Sunday against the bleak Toronto Raptors, who lost two in 48 hours against Orlando.

Franz Wagner (23 points) was Orlando’s top scorer while in Toronto, with Spaniard Juancho Hernangomez still missing due to an ankle injury. Gary Trent Jr. (24 points).
